This is a special kind of formatting that’s only important if you’re writing for network television. Whenever you reach the end of an act (or teaser) where the show would cut to commercial break, note it by putting “End of Act One,” (or Two or Three) centered and underlined, into your script. fit4life mcgee\u0027s crossroads ncWeb"HORROR" SAMPLE COMIC SCRIPT - JOHNSTON - 1.
